After reading some rather negative reviews, we were very pleasantly surprised by the service, food, décor – in short, pretty much everything – on our week-long Mediterranean cruise on the Regent Explorer. This was our third Regent cruise, and probably my 15th cruise overall.

Our positive experience began with embarkation. After a short bus ride from the pre-cruise hotel, we moved quickly through the check-in stations, and soon found ourselves on the ship and toasting with a glass of champagne. It was without a doubt the most efficient boarding process I'd ever had.

I was concerned that we would have nothing to do between our early-afternoon embarkation and sailing, which wasn't until 9 p.m., but I needn't have worried. We had a delightful lunch in the Veranda, treated ourselves to a lengthy and luxurious couples massage that was discounted for embarkation day, relaxed on our balcony, and then had dinner in Chartreuse, one of the specialty restaurants. Be sure to reserve your table early!

Cabin Review

Concierge Suite

Our cabin was cleaned impeccably twice daily. Everything was in good condition. We appreciated that the bed was perpendicular to the hall - friends who cruised recently pointed out that this allows a soothing rocking motion. It also allowed a nice view to the outside! There was plenty of storage for us on our week-long voyage. Two sinks in the bath were much appreciated.
